You'll see blood pumping through the heart of a tiny, developing embryo if you candle a fertile egg on Day 4. If the embryo dies at this point, you may still see a faint network of blood vessels inside the egg's contents. An embryo dying at this point will show a large, black eye.

While most female birds have no problems laying eggs, occasionally they may encounter difficulty. When detected early, egg … Web29 jul. 2024 · Most birds can tell if their egg is non-viable. Avian experts suggest that most birds can tell the health of an egg by: Change in weight by drying out. Discoloration or turning brown. Putrid smell. Cessation of movement.
